Meaning of Dhrupad

Dhrupad originates from the Sanskrit language, combining the words ‘dhruva’ (fixed or constant) and ‘pada’ (foot or step). This gives the name its primary meaning of ‘firm-footed’ or ‘steadfast,’ symbolizing stability and unwavering devotion. In the context of Indian classical music, Dhrupad refers to one of the oldest and most revered forms of Hindustani music, known for its spiritual depth and rigorous structure. The name thus embodies both a personal quality of resilience and a cultural heritage of artistic excellence. Its usage in ancient texts and musical traditions highlights its enduring significance.

Origin & Cultural Significance

Dhrupad has its roots in ancient Sanskrit literature and Indian classical music traditions. It is prominently associated with Hindu culture, where names derived from Sanskrit often carry spiritual and philosophical meanings. The Dhrupad style of music dates back to the Vedic period and has been preserved through generations in families like the Dagars. As a personal name, Dhrupad is commonly used in India and among Hindu communities worldwide, reflecting a connection to tradition and artistry. Its cultural significance extends beyond mere nomenclature, representing a legacy of discipline and devotion.
